Good morning I would like to know from you whether a lawyer has the obligation to investigate whether a person is entitled to a lawyer of inability before offering his services for an hourly rate of € 235.00. this concerns a divorce procedure Since we have been making losses for several years, we hope to get out of it without any debt.Lawyer
Ir/Madam, They do have this obligation, see: https://www.advocatenorde.nl/advocaten/juridische-databank/uitspraken/details/7592 Quote: '1 A lawyer has an active duty to investigate the possibility of legal aid for his client. The mere notification by the client that he is not eligible for this does not release the lawyer from this duty, given the complicated system of legal aid. ' The lawyer you hire must offer to provide legal aid. You can check on the website of the Legal Aid Board whether you qualify for legal aid: http://rvr.org/nl/subhome_rz/rechtsbijstandverlener,Inkomensgrenzen.htmlQuestioner
